Frequency monitoring relay
• the relay serves to monitor frequency of AC voltage, e.g. in photovoltaic power
stations, generators
• the monitored frequency 50 / 60 / 400 Hz is selected by a switch
• supplied from monitored voltage
• two adjustable levels of frequency (Fmin, Fmax) in the range of 80 - 120 % Fn
• adjustable dierence level
• adjustable delay level
• switchable ranges of rated frequency Fn
• 3-MODULE design, DIN rail mounting

Warning
Technical parameters
Device is constructed for connection in 1-phase main alternating current voltage and
must be installed according to norms valid in the state of application. Connection
according to the details in this direction. Installation, connection, setting and servicing
should be installed by qualied electrician sta only, who has learnt these instruction
and functions of the device. This device contains protection against overvoltage
peaks and disturbancies in supply. For correct function of the protection of this device
there must be suitable protections of higher degree (A, B, C) installed in front of them.
According to standards elimination of disturbancies must be ensured. Before installation
the main switch must be in position “OFF” and the device should be de-energized.
Don´t install the device to sources of excessive electro-magnetic interference. By correct
installation ensure ideal air circulation so in case of permanent operation and higher
ambient temperature the maximal operating temperature of the device is not exceeded.
For installation and setting use screw-driver cca 2 mm. The device is fully-electronic -
installation should be carried out according to this fact. Non-problematic function
depends also on the way of transportation, storing and handling. In case of any signs
of destruction, deformation, nonfunction or missing part, don´t install and claim at your
seller.

After the supply (monitored) voltage is connected, the green LED is on.
If the value of the monitored frequency falls within the range between the two set levels
Fmin - Fmax no red LED is on. The relay UNDER is triggered (contacts 15-16-18) and the
relay OVER is disconnected (contacts 25-26-28).
If the monitored frequency exceeds the set level Fmax, the relay OVER is triggered after
the set delay timing elapses and the red LED OVER goes on. The red LED ashes during
the timing.
If the monitored frequency drops below Fmax - dierence, the relay is activated without
delay and the red LED OVER goes o.
If the monitored frequency drops below the set level Fmin, the relay UNDER is
disconnected after the set delay timing elapses and the red LED UNDER goes on. The red
LED ashes during the timing. If the monitored frequency exceeds the level Fmin + the
dierence, the relay is triggered without delay and the red LED UNDER goes o.
If the monitored voltage is lower than the opening level Uopen both the relays are
disconnected and both the red LED (UNDER and OVER) start ashing slowly - indicating
insucient supply voltage.
